Our story began when families started arriving with hope in their eyes and paperwork in their hands. A father asked how to prepare immigration forms. A grandmother unfolded Social Security letters she couldn’t decipher. A young mother placed a blank application for public assistance on the table and whispered, “I don’t know where to start.” We saw this again and again—especially within the Arab and Arabic-speaking community, where language and cultural gaps too often shut doors. Many could not afford even a minimal fee.
Nebrass Inclusion grew from those moments. We are an immigrant-integration organization providing non-legal, administrative help: interpretation and translation, document preparation and organization, and patient, step-by-step guidance through public systems. We also offer faith-sensitive coaching and culturally informed orientation so families can integrate with confidence and dignity. When cost is a barrier, we keep fees modest and offer sliding-scale options and limited fee waivers based on clear, written criteria and our capacity.
Our director, Ahmed Eid, brings years of service with nonprofit organizations in the Middle East and the United States, along with formal training and comparative knowledge of legal systems including Egypt and Saudi Arabia. His background strengthens our standards, supervision, and the care we bring to every client file.
This is how our story began: by listening first, serving with respect, and standing beside our neighbors until complicated forms feel possible.
(We are not attorneys and do not provide legal advice or legal representation. All services are limited to non-legal administrative support.)

Phase Two scales impact. With your support, we will launch Cool School (our summer camp), expand cultural seminars and integration programs, and complete Department of Justice Recognition and Accreditation. If approved, accredited representatives at Nebrass will be authorized to provide certain immigration legal services consistent with their level of accreditation, including appearances before USCIS and, with full accreditation, before immigration courts and the BIA.

We Served clients nationwide in Arabic and English. Guided families through immigration document preparation and evidence organization based on their information. Supported seniors with Social Security and health-coverage paperwork. Delivered food baskets when urgent needs arose and taught households how to access SNAP, Medicaid/Medicare, and other assistance they can sustain. Translated hundreds of documents. Interpreted at hundreds of USCIS appointments and interviews. Helped couples communicate through stressful processes so families stay together.
